SHOT BY POLICE.
AFTER EXCHANGE OF FIRE. TRAGEDY IN NEW SOUTH WALES (Rep. 1.10) SYDNEY, This Day. A soldier Avas shot dead at Orange, New Soutli Wales, last night by a detective, at whom he .had previously fired. Afto- a quarrel with his wife, aged 17, Pnvate Carl Hutchinson, aged 20, fired a shot at her but missed. He then threatened to do some more shooting. The police Avere called and Hutchinson is said to have fired point blank at a detective. The shot missed and the policeman fired back at Hutchinson, hitting him in the chest and killing him instantly.
